Our choir brings together singers who want to learn, improve and perform as part of a supportive musical group. We offer a junior choir for ages 10 to 16 and an adult community choir for singers who are ready to rehearse and contribute as part of an ensemble.

Rehearsals focus on musical teamwork and building strong ensemble skills. Whether you are a young singer beginning your music-reading journey or an adult looking for a committed choir experience, there is a place for you here.

Adult Choir

Our Adult Choir is open to community members who enjoy singing and want to be part of a collaborative ensemble. Everyone is welcome, but singers do need to be able to sing confidently enough to contribute in rehearsal, since each voice plays an important role in the group.

The Adult Choir meets weekly from 6:30 to 8:30 p.m. Rehearsals are focused, rewarding and built around ensemble commitment, musical growth and community.

We are also more understanding of senior singers during the audition process.

Junior Choir

For ages 10 to 16

Our Junior Choir is a great fit for young singers who already know how to match pitch and are ready to grow in a structured, encouraging setting.

Singers meet once a week from 4:30 to 5:45 p.m. Rehearsals include 45 minutes of singing and song work, along with instruction designed to help students build musicianship and learn how to read music.

We are especially mindful of age and development during auditions, and expectations for junior singers are more flexible than for adults.

Auditions

What to expect:

  • A simple vocal assessment

  • A chance to demonstrate pitch matching and singing ability

  • A friendly, supportive process

Bring to your audition:

  • Water bottle

  • Pencil

Both the Junior Choir and Adult Choir require an audition. Auditions help us place singers well and create a strong experience for every member of the choir.

For Junior Choir auditions, we understand that they are still developing their voice and skills so it is less rigorous than the Adult Choir audition. Our goal is to make auditions comfortable while still ensuring each singer is ready for the rehearsal setting.
